ClusterAr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"mbekjgkkmwnenvbo")
suspend fun annotations(value: Output<Map<String, String>>)
@JvmName(name = "qdpjgyqfrbpjuank")
fun annotations(vararg values: Pair<String, String>)
@JvmName(name = "nmbjnadiqvdjeern")
suspend fun annotations(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"lqqybbaivbvnawtt")
suspend fun automatedBackupPolicy(value: Output<ClusterAutomatedBackupPolicyArgs>)
@JvmName(name = "gqiotlqjhxeaemib")
suspend fun automatedBackupPolicy(value: ClusterAutomatedBackupPolicyArgs?)
@JvmName(name = "ahccnerrflreumon")
suspend fun automatedBackupPolicy(argument: suspend ClusterAutomatedBackupPolicy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"kbdigdeugwoesugy")
suspend fun clusterId(value: Output<String>)
@JvmName(name = "bkvbofhvkxekuvyn")
suspend fun clusterId(value: String?)
Link copied to clipboard
@JvmName(name = "uhloocqihtmqaxgc")
suspend fun clusterType(value: Output<String>)
@JvmName(name = "blnblhcgywhnkrbx")
suspend fun clusterType(value: String?)
Link copied to clipboard
@JvmName(name = "bpibipsjktapqmud")
suspend fun continuousBackupConfig(value: Output<ClusterContinuousBackupConfigArgs>)
@JvmName(name = "beskycmhqwdpveyt")
suspend fun continuousBackupConfig(value: ClusterContinuousBackupConfigArgs?)
@JvmName(name = "xegceyjbdrokotab")
suspend fun continuousBackupConfig(argument: suspend ClusterContinuousBackupCon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"hqlgdaygnaiqbjyy")
suspend fun databaseVersion(value: Output<String>)
@JvmName(name = "jylfxtfuehtnhjwd")
suspend fun databaseVersion(value: String?)
Link copied to clipboard
@JvmName(name = "akyfybikbtndvxqp")
suspend fun deletionPolicy(value: Output<String>)
@JvmName(name = "hkmayfwgnreipqet")
suspend fun deletionPolicy(value: String?)
Link copied to clipboard
@JvmName(name = "hmgtplrpagewikif")
suspend fun displayName(value: Output<String>)
@JvmName(name = "oavhpcxxbioouoto")
suspend fun displayName(value: String?)
Link copied to clipboard
@JvmName(name = "goyvlomftlauwauo")
suspend fun encryptionConfig(value: Output<ClusterEncryptionConfigArgs>)
@JvmName(name = "pvywpprkxhcchyns")
suspend fun encryptionConfig(value: ClusterEncryptionConfigArgs?)
@JvmName(name = "yvpnrsbmqbmbrupm")
suspend fun encryptionConfig(argument: suspend ClusterEncryptionCon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"uboimdiihrvngytg")
suspend fun etag(value: Output<String>)
@JvmName(name = "pffyloxqvpdylufs")
suspend fun etag(value: String?)
Link copied to clipboard
@JvmName(name = "ahjkdakrthxcvwxx")
suspend fun initialUser(value: Output<ClusterInitialUserArgs>)
@JvmName(name = "gfotajjurmtqsawa")
suspend fun initialUser(value: ClusterInitialUserArgs?)
@JvmName(name = "vmbfjhrfyfhscghk")
suspend fun initialUser(argument: suspend ClusterInitialUserAr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"uarhhyodtiixsesm")
suspend fun labels(value: Output<Map<String, String>>)
@JvmName(name = "rbimesbgrcjngktb")
fun labels(vararg values: Pair<String, String>)
@JvmName(name = "iajsnntsrgankptv")
suspend fun labels(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"yiivdagoqelrhfye")
suspend fun location(value: Output<String>)
@JvmName(name = "kqvpnabibnynsmmy")
suspend fun location(value: String?)
Link copied to clipboard
@JvmName(name = "qdqltmuraydmxkxb")
suspend fun maintenanceUpdatePolicy(value: Output<ClusterMaintenanceUpdatePolicyArgs>)
@JvmName(name = "hivjwcxaipyihfvq")
suspend fun maintenanceUpdatePolicy(value: ClusterMaintenanceUpdatePolicyArgs?)
@JvmName(name = "dbyuwwuibannfidp")
suspend fun maintenanceUpdatePolicy(argument: suspend ClusterMaintenanceUpdatePolicyAr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"xytdvmoilwyxxynj")
suspend fun networkConfig(value: Output<ClusterNetworkConfigArgs>)
@JvmName(name = "mukohsevramjdfyv")
suspend fun networkConfig(value: ClusterNetworkConfigArgs?)
@JvmName(name = "msfdrswnrkydmmeo")
suspend fun networkConfig(argument: suspend ClusterNetworkCon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"wqpnqoqmtxyhjtyu")
suspend fun project(value: Output<String>)
@JvmName(name = "lvuwsgxihbjlrpax")
suspend fun project(value: String?)
Link copied to clipboard
@JvmName(name = "tigsairctituyiii")
suspend fun pscConfig(value: Output<ClusterPscConfigArgs>)
@JvmName(name = "knsyxfrgxkcqlfms")
suspend fun pscConfig(value: ClusterPscConfigArgs?)
@JvmName(name = "utyaubiqbbnyaehu")
suspend fun pscConfig(argument: suspend ClusterPscCon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"sbucnnvbokwfeblg")
suspend fun restoreBackupSource(value: Output<ClusterRestoreBackupSourceArgs>)
@JvmName(name = "lxmeiiiwocaynopl")
suspend fun restoreBackupSource(value: ClusterRestoreBackupSourceArgs?)
@JvmName(name = "hihcrxedjguphrjw")
suspend fun restoreBackupSource(argument: suspend ClusterRestoreBackupSourceAr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"gcvdqmjgmufbomqh")
suspend fun restoreContinuousBackupSource(value: Output<ClusterRestoreContinuousBackupSourceArgs>)
@JvmName(name = "lfypvsvocljuhpgv")
suspend fun restoreContinuousBackupSource(argument: suspend ClusterRestoreContinuousBackupSourceAr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"lovltsundexfbahk")
suspend fun secondaryConfig(value: Output<ClusterSecondaryConfigArgs>)
@JvmName(name = "fdvovqawcjreiwov")
suspend fun secondaryConfig(value: ClusterSecondaryConfigArgs?)
@JvmName(name = "vyaugxksddbrgjud")
suspend fun secondaryConfig(argument: suspend ClusterSecondaryConfigAr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"yrjhhleadeunvajy")
suspend fun skipAwaitMajorVersionUpgrade(value: Output<Boolean>)
@JvmName(name = "ljfvhcxlwatgwwvm")
suspend fun skipAwaitMajorVersionUpgrade(value: Boolean?)
Link copied to clipboard
@JvmName(name = "kuxmgancsoykrngf")
suspend fun subscriptionType(value: Output<String>)
@JvmName(name = "julscwinttghgjmj")
suspend fun subscriptionType(value: String?)